Job Summary
The primary responsibility is to lead assigned projects to successful completion within the established schedule and scope while ensuring targeted profitability.
Key duties include resolving complex issues involving clients, consultants, and subcontractors that escalate beyond the scope of subordinate staff.
Candidates must have a proven track record as a Project or Technical Manager for large-scale construction projects exceeding S$100M in Singapore.
